Cousiño Macul is one of the most beautiful vineyards from Chile.

This incredible vineyards stay in the middle of the capital of Chile, Santiago and you ´ll love to visit this amazing tour.

You must get to know this wonderful place.Their wines are the best in Chile and world.

That´s why their wines has always been internationally awarded.

Tour day and evening. ( 10:00 am or 14:30 p.m.)

Ask me about the schedule.

- It´s included : Transfer and Confortable clean minivan with air conditioner

- Private services

- Guide Trilingue ( English, Portugues and Spanish)

- Duration of the tour: 1:45 hour

- Itinerary:

-Pick at your Hotel

- Included entrance to the vineyard

- Walk in the middle of the grape trees

- Visit to the originals cellars - Since 1887

- Tasting of 3 glass of wines first then 4 types of their Premium wines
7 glass of wines in total

- A beautiful free glass of wine for your remind
